Chumoukedima clinch senior men’s inter district cricket tourney title

Chumoukedima were crowned champions of the Senior Men’s Inter District Tournament 2026 after defeating Dimapur by six wickets in the final at Nagaland Cricket Stadium, Chumoukedima on Friday. A disciplined bowling performance followed by a composed batting display sealed their dominant campaign.
Opting to field first, Chumoukedima’s bowlers dismantled Dimapur’s batting lineup, restricting them to just 80 runs in 25.1 overs. Shamphri Terang was the lone resistance, scoring 26 off 34 balls, while the rest of the batting order faltered against relentless pressure. Neizekho Rupreo spearheaded the attack with outstanding figures of 4/16 in 7.1 overs, earning him the Player of the Match award. He was ably supported by Imliwati (3/15) and Ravi Kumar Ram (2/36), ensuring Dimapur never found momentum.
In reply, Chumoukedima chased down the modest target with ease, reaching 85/4 in 17.1 overs. Jonathan Rongsen’s brisk 27 off 21 balls and Aloto Sumi’s 23 off 19 provided stability, guiding the team to victory without major setbacks. Dimapur’s bowlers, Hopongkyu Sangtam (2/23) and Sundram Gupta (2/12), picked up wickets but were unable to defend the low total.
The final result capped off Chumoukedima’s impressive run in the tournament, showcasing their strength across all departments.
In the individual awards, Player of the Tournament was Imliwati Lemtur (Chumoukedima); Best Batsman by Aloto Sumi (Chumoukedima); Best Bowler by Imliwati Lemtur (Chumoukedima); and Best Wicketkeeper by Yugandhar Singh (Chumoukedima).
